Rigid Board — The Permanent Structure Behind Every Luxury Box
Rigid board — also called greyboard, chipboard, or bookbinding board — is a dense, compressed paperboard that does not fold or flex. Unlike standard packaging paperboard which ships flat and is assembled at the filling line, rigid board is constructed into permanent box forms at the manufacturing facility. The density and thickness of rigid board creates the substantial, weighty feel that consumers associate with premium quality.
We use 1.5mm, 2mm, 2.5mm, and 3mm rigid board depending on application. The board is wrapped with printed or specialty papers, fabrics, or leather-effect materials to create the finished exterior of rigid boxes. The board provides structural permanence; the wrapping provides brand and aesthetic identity.
Rigid Board Thickness Selection
Rigid board thickness determines the weight and perceived quality of the finished box. 1.5mm is used for lightweight applications including earring boxes, small cosmetic boxes, and light-product gift packaging where a thin but permanent structure is needed. 2mm is appropriate for standard jewelry boxes, cosmetic gift sets, and mid-weight product packaging. 2.5mm is the standard for most luxury retail and corporate gift applications. 3mm provides maximum structural rigidity for large boxes, heavy products, and applications where maximum premium feel is the priority.
Greyboard vs White Board
Standard rigid packaging uses grey chipboard (greyboard) as the structural core. The grey color is not visible in the finished box because the exterior is fully wrapped with printing paper. White board (white rigid board with clay-coated surface) is used for applications where interior surfaces are visible and a white base is required — typically for printing on the interior of the box without separate interior lining.
Wrapping Materials for Rigid Board
The wrapping material applied over rigid board defines the box's exterior aesthetic. Coated paper in matte, gloss, or soft-touch lamination provides the widest range of print-based brand expression. Specialty papers (pearlescent, metallic, embossed, textured) add distinctive surface character. Fabric materials (linen, cotton, velvet) create textile-quality packaging. What is the weight of rigid board packaging compared to folding cartons?
Rigid board packaging is significantly heavier than folding cartons — a 2.5mm greyboard box weighs 5-10x more than a comparable folding carton. This weight is perceived by consumers as a quality signal: heavier packaging communicates more premium product. The weight also increases shipping cost — a tradeoff brands consciously choose when investing in rigid packaging.
Can rigid board boxes be shipped flat to reduce freight?
Standard rigid boxes ship assembled and cannot be flattened. Collapsible rigid boxes (also called foldable rigid boxes) ship flat and pop into rigid structure at the destination — a compromise between freight efficiency and the premium rigid box aesthetic. We produce both formats.
What adhesives are used in rigid board box construction?
Hot melt adhesive is the standard for rigid box assembly — it provides a strong, fast bond compatible with high-speed production. PVA (polyvinyl acetate) adhesive is used for applications requiring flexibility or where hot melt would cause substrate distortion.
Is rigid board packaging recyclable?
Rigid greyboard is recyclable paper-based material. However, the wrapping paper, fabric, and adhesive used in rigid box construction create a mixed-material structure that is challenging for standard recycling streams. Rigid boxes are frequently kept and reused by consumers, which extends their useful life beyond single-use packaging.
